About this book

Old Testament

1 SamuelThe transition from judges to monarchy. Samuel rises as prophet-judge; Israel demands a king; Saul rises and is rejected; David is anointed in obscurity and flees across the wilderness. Three lives overlapping — the prophetic-judicial-royal handoff.

Author
Traditionally Samuel (with additions after his death by Nathan and Gad — cf. 1 Chr 29:29)
Date
Events c. 1050–1010 BC; compilation during the early monarchy
